Ronald Dale Mahan, 56, beloved husband, father, brother and grandfather passed away Friday, August 9, 2013 at his home in Dadeville Alabama while surrounded by family and friends.

He was survived by his loving wife: Shawn Mahan, stepson: Evan Godwin and his wife Samantha of Valley, Al., stepdaughter: Kate Tuft and her husband Justin of Opelika, Al. and four grandchildren. Mr. Mahan is also survived by his brother: Lonnie Mahan, 71, of Lubbock, Tx., sister: Jo Ann Jones, 67, of West Valley City, Ut., sister, Carolyn Hass,65, of McAlester, Ok., brother: Lester Mahan,64, of Cheyenne Wy. and brother Bobby Mahan,60, of Lubbock, Tx.

Mr. Mahan was preceded in death by parents: Leslie and Frances Mahan and brother Ray Mahan of Idalou, Tx.

Master Chief Ronald Mahan will receive full military honors at Alabama National Cemetery at Montevallo, Al. on Tuesday, August 13, 2013 at 2:00 P.M. Alabama Funeral Homes and Cremation Centers of Dadeville Al. is handling arrangements. www.alabamafuneralhomes.com
